Patents Assigned to Nemag, B.V.
  • Patent number: 10252892
    Abstract: A four cable operated scissors grab, comprising a pair of scissor levers that are connected via a pivot joint to pivot about a pivoting axis, which scissor levers each include a grab shell and a hoist cable connection situated on a first side of the lever with respect to the pivot joint, and a closing cable connection situated on a second side of the lever that is opposite with respect to the pivot joint, so that in use a dedicated hoisting cable is fastened to each lever on the first side of the lever, and a dedicated closing cable is fastened to each lever at the second side of the lever. The scissor levers each include a sheave on the second side of the lever, and said sheaves are each arranged as a first and final closing sheave, so that in use each of the two closing cables extend in a single pass from a closing cable connection on the second side of one lever via the closing sheave on the second side of the other lever to depart from the grab and continue upward to a crane carrying the grab.

  • Patent number: 4538848
    Abstract: A grab comprising two grab buckets (2,3) pivoted together by means of plate-like carrier arms (15,16,22,23) mounted on a pivotal shaft (8). The carrier arms (15,16,22,23) extend from the bottom of a bucket to beyond the pivotal shaft (8) and are substantially parallel to each other. The carrier arms (15,16) of one bucket (2) are located on opposite sides of a median plane perpendicular to the pivotal shaft. The two carrier arms (15,16) are interconnected at least at their ends (19) and provided with guide pulleys and "close" pulleys (11,12) for guiding the closing ropes (6). The ends (27,28) of the carrier arms (22,23) of the other bucket (3) are made of double-walled construction by means of stiffening plates (25,26) connected to them in spaced relationship thereto. The carrier arms are arranged to pass by each other, so that the grab can be fully opened (FIG. 2b). Closing ropes (6) are secured to the ends of the carrier arms (22,23) of the other bucket (3).

  • Patent number: 4395066
    Abstract: A grab comprising a pair of buckets interconnected by way of arms capable of pivoting movement relative to each other, and the free ends of which are provided with sheaves for guiding operating or closing ropes by which the buckets can be opened and closed. The rear edges of the buckets are secured by way of ropes or the like to a cross-beam, to which the hoist ropes are connected. According to the invention, the arms are provided at some distance from their free ends with arcuate bridge members or elevations, directed to one another, which roll one over the other as the grab buckets are opened and closed.

  • Patent number: 4176872
    Abstract: A grab or the like substantially comprising a frame or upper structure having for each grab bucket pivoting levers, at the end of which there is positioned the pivot point of a grab bucket, while each grab bucket can furthermore be pulled by means of a rope to the opened position and via a lever system connected to a pulley block movable in the frame, into the closing position, whereby each grab bucket is connected through a pair of levers to a pulley block such that, in the opened position of the grab buckets, this can form an angle of 180.degree., while the grab buckets, in an intermediate position of the movable pulley block, sealingly abut against the lower and side boundary edges.

  • Patent number: 4143901
    Abstract: A mechanical grab consisting essentially of a frame within which round-bottomed scoops with straight-walled sides can be rotated about an axis in such a manner that, when the grab shuts, the mutually facing walls of the scoops are upwardly movable in overlapping relationship while the relative speed with which each of the scoops rotates about its axis is different.
